To find the value of x, you need to isolate/get the variable "x" by itself in the equation:
x = -3x + 5 Add 3x on both sides to get "x" on one side of the equation
x + 3x = -3x + 3x + 5
4x = 5 Divide 4 on both sides to get "x" by itself
[tex]\frac{4x}{4}=\frac{5}{4}[/tex]
[tex]x=\frac{5}{4}[/tex]
